In the ever-evolving landscape of the digital age, where transactions, contracts, and communication occur predominantly online, the need for secure and verifiable methods of authentication is paramount. Enter the world of digital signatures – a technological marvel that ensures the integrity, authenticity, and non-repudiation of digital documents and transactions. In this article, we will delve into the concept, mechanics, benefits, and applications of digital signatures.
Understanding Digital Signatures:
Imagine you’re sending a handwritten letter to a friend. You sign your name at the bottom to let your friend know that the letter indeed came from you. Similarly, in the digital realm, a digital signature serves as a virtual seal of authenticity for electronic documents, messages, or transactions. It’s a unique code that’s attached to a digital document to confirm that it’s genuinely from the sender and hasn’t been tampered with during transmission.
However, unlike a handwritten signature, a digital signature is not an image of your name. Instead, it’s a complex mathematical algorithm that’s based on the content of the document and the sender’s private key. This ensures that even the slightest alteration to the document would result in a different signature, making it nearly impossible to forge or tamper with.
How Digital Signatures Work:
The process of using a digital signature involves two main components: the private key and the public key. These are part of a cryptographic key pair, where the private key is known only to the owner, while the public key is freely available.
1.Creating the Signature: The sender uses their private key to create a unique digital signature for a specific document. This signature is created by performing complex mathematical operations on the content of the document.
2.Attaching the Signature: The digital signature is attached to the document. It’s like sealing an envelope with a unique stamp.
3.Verification: When the recipient receives the document, they use the sender’s public key (which is openly available) to verify the digital signature. If the signature matches the document’s content and the sender’s public key, it means the document is authentic and hasn’t been tampered with.
Benefits of Digital Signatures:
1.Security and Authenticity: Digital signatures provide a high level of security. They ensure that the document was indeed sent by the claimed sender and that it hasn’t been altered in any way during transmission.
2.Non-Repudiation: Once a sender attaches their digital signature to a document, they cannot later deny having sent it. This concept is known as non-repudiation, and it’s essential for legal and business transactions.
3.Efficiency: Digital signatures eliminate the need for printing, signing, and scanning documents. This streamlines processes and reduces the time and resources required for authentication.
4.Reduced Paperwork: As traditional signatures often require physical paperwork, adopting digital signatures contributes to a more eco-friendly and sustainable approach to document handling.
Applications of Digital Signatures:
1.Business Contracts: In the corporate world, digital signatures have revolutionized contract management. Businesses can securely sign agreements, sales contracts, and legal documents electronically, facilitating faster transactions and reducing paperwork.
2.E-Government Services: Digital signatures enable citizens to interact with government agencies and complete various administrative tasks online. This includes submitting tax forms, applying for permits, and signing official documents.
3.E-Commerce: In online shopping, digital signatures ensure the authenticity of transactions. They also play a vital role in verifying the legitimacy of e-commerce websites, providing consumers with a sense of security.
4.Healthcare and Legal Documents: In the healthcare industry, digital signatures simplify the process of obtaining patient consent, sharing medical records securely, and ensuring compliance with regulations. In the legal field, digital signatures validate contracts, agreements, and court documents.
5.Document Authentication: Academic institutions and research organizations use digital signatures to validate academic transcripts, research papers, and other important documents.
Challenges and Considerations:
While digital signatures offer numerous benefits, their implementation requires attention to security measures. Safeguarding private keys and employing strong encryption protocols are essential to prevent unauthorized access and potential breaches.
In Conclusion: In an era where the digital realm intertwines with our everyday lives, the need for secure and trustworthy methods of authentication is vital. Digital signatures stand as a technological marvel, ensuring the integrity, authenticity, and non-repudiation of digital documents and transactions. By harnessing the power of cryptography, digital signatures are transforming the way we conduct business, interact with government agencies, and safeguard our digital interactions, contributing to a safer and more efficient digital world.
I am still not clear, please read more . . .
Imagine you have a secret code that you use to show that you’re the one who wrote a special letter. This code is like your own magical stamp that only you can use. Now, in the world of computers and the internet, we have something similar called a “digital signature.”
When grown-ups send important stuff through the computer, like important letters or special pictures, they want to make sure that nobody changes the stuff while it’s traveling from one place to another. So, they use a digital signature to put their own magical stamp on it.
This digital signature is like a secret code that only the grown-up knows, just like your secret code for your stamp. It helps everyone know that the special stuff really came from that grown-up and that nobody messed with it on the way.
And guess what? This digital signature is super smart! It’s like a puzzle piece that only fits with one specific picture. If the picture changes even a little bit, the puzzle piece won’t fit anymore, and everyone will know that something is not right.
So, just like your magical stamp shows that you wrote a letter, a digital signature shows that a grown-up sent something important from the computer. It’s like a secret code that makes sure everything stays safe and nobody tricks us while things are flying around the internet!
Digital Signature and How to install, configure and use it
Obtaining, installing, configuring, and using a digital signature involves a few steps. Here’s a general guide to help you understand the process:
1. Obtaining a Digital Signature:
There are a few different ways to obtain a digital signature:
- Certification Authorities (CAs): These are trusted organizations that issue digital certificates. You can purchase a digital certificate from a CA. Some well-known CAs include DigiCert, GlobalSign, and Comodo.
- Software Providers: Some software companies offer tools that generate digital signatures. These might come bundled with other security software.
- Built-in Tools: Some operating systems or applications have built-in tools for generating digital signatures.
2. Installing and Configuring:
Once you’ve obtained a digital certificate, you’ll need to install and configure it. The exact steps can vary depending on the platform you’re using (Windows, macOS, etc.) and the type of certificate you have (software-based, hardware-based, etc.).
For Windows:
– Double-click the digital certificate file to start the installation process.
– Follow the on-screen instructions to import the certificate into your computer’s certificate store.
– Depending on the purpose of the certificate (personal, business, etc.), you might need to configure additional settings.
For macOS:
– Double-click the digital certificate file to start the installation process.
– Follow the on-screen instructions to import the certificate into your Keychain Access.
– Configure your Keychain settings to allow the use of the certificate for digital signatures.
3. Using a Digital Signature:
Once your digital certificate is installed and configured, you can use it to digitally sign documents, emails, and other types of files. Here’s a general idea of how to use it:
For Emails:
1. Compose your email as you normally would.
2. Depending on your email client, there should be an option to add a digital signature. This might be a button or an option in the email settings.
3. Choose your digital certificate when prompted. The email client will attach the digital signature to the email.
For Documents:
1. Open the document you want to digitally sign.
2. Depending on the software you’re using, there should be an option to digitally sign the document. This might be under a “Security” or “Tools” menu.
3. Choose your digital certificate and follow the prompts. The software will apply the digital signature to the document.
It’s important to note that the exact steps can vary based on the software you’re using and the type of digital certificate you have. Some software might also require additional setup, like setting up a secure token or smart card if you have a hardware-based certificate.
Remember that digital signatures are used to prove the authenticity and integrity of your documents or communications. They provide an extra layer of security and confidence that the content hasn’t been altered and that it genuinely comes from you.
Since the steps and interfaces can vary based on your specific setup, it’s a good idea to refer to the documentation provided by your digital certificate provider and the software you’re using for more detailed instructions tailored to your situation.
Hey Guys!!! Hope you like this post. Please share your views below.
This article brilliantly demystifies the power and importance of digital signatures in our digital world. A must-read for anyone concerned about security and authenticity online!